Questions about this workflow
What if my Salesforce assignment rules conflict?
Salesforce runs through your rules in order and applies the first match. Notis respects that same logic.
Can I see which rule was applied?
Yes. The run report will show that assignment rules were applied, and you can check the lead owner in Salesforce to see the result.
What if no rule applies?
The lead stays unassigned until someone manually assigns it, or you can configure a fallback owner in your automation prompt.
